After answering a few simple questions through a visual quiz, users are introduced to one of seven design personalities that best resonates with their style. Design personalities include: The Collector: Every piece in her home tells a story. The Collector mixes textures from found objects with more classic styles for a palette based on rich browns and dark lichen. Light is brought in by sunshine yellow and soft greens. The Socialite: The Socialite knows confidence is her best accessory. She's self-assured at home and at work – always leading by example. Lighter grays and warm tones of sand are balanced by rich, jet black to create a feeling of luxury and longevity. The Multi-tasker: The Multi-Tasker approaches life at full force – balancing and adjusting to the moment to meet it with exuberance. A family-friendly palette that is fresh, realistic, modern and classic – and infused with a much-needed jolt of coffee. The Entertainer: With an eye for modern sophistication, the Entertainer is comfortable no matter where he is – which is usually at the center of any situation. Graphic red and black contrast for a high-end feel, but are softened with warm taupe and golden yellow for a truly sophisticated theme. The Creator: The Creator loves anything quirky; what most people shy away from, he embraces. Mixed media, textures and inspirations make the color palette. From pairing water blues with coffee browns, this is experimentation at its bravest. The Naturalist: The Naturalist feels most at home in the great outdoors and strives to bring a sense of well-being into her home. Soft buttery browns complement light beige and cream tones while speckle textures commonly found in stone and granite inspire solid surfaces. The Traveler: The world is his inspiration. The Traveler mixes the best objects found in his travels – things that have an international significance to his life – to create a multi-cultural lifestyle. Anything exotic and unique is his normal; pottery clay, cobalt and indigo his color palette.
